So, what is farine de chataîgnes?
Farine de châtaignes, also known as chestnut flour, is a gluten-free ingredient made from ground dried chestnuts. It has a nutty and sweet flavor, making it a versatile addition to both sweet and savory recipes. In addition to being a great substitute for wheat flour in baking, it can also be used to thicken soups and stews or to make crepes and pancakes. Chestnut flour is high in fiber and protein, and it's also a good source of vitamins and minerals like vitamin C, potassium, and magnesium. It's a popular ingredient in Mediterranean cuisine and is a great option for those with gluten sensitivities or following a grain-free diet.
